10.3.4
Synchronizing GP Timer Blocks
The GPTM Synchronizer Control (GPTMSYNC) register in the GPTM0 block can be used to
synchronize selected timers to begin counting at the same time. Setting a bit in the GPTMSYNC
register causes the associated timer to perform the actions of a timeout event. An interrupt is not
generated when the timers are synchronized. If a timer is being used in concatenated mode, only
the bit for Timer A must be set in the GPTMSYNC register.
Note: All timers must use the same clock source for this feature to work correctly.
Table 10-11 on page 651 shows the actions for the timeout event performed when the timers are
synchronized in the various timer modes.
